Frequently Asked Questions
Q: How do I identify a sleeper who will survive a bye week?
A: Look for players with solid health trends, high target volume, and favorable third-down usage. Pair those metrics with a team’s bye-week schedule to ensure the sleeper remains a viable starter when opponents lose their own top options.
Q: Why focus on PPP instead of raw point projections?
A: PPP measures efficiency per budget dollar, letting you maximize output under a salary cap. It highlights low-cost players who deliver points comparable to higher-priced stars, a critical factor for budget-centric leagues.
Q: Are rookie tight ends worth drafting in a budget league?
A: Yes, especially when they showed high college target shares and play in offenses that value the position. Trey McBride’s record season illustrates how a tight end can become a top-10 fantasy option, and comparable rookies can be acquired at a fraction of the cost.
